When Robert Rauschenberg, in his work Monogram, chose to use a variety of non-traditional art materials and techniques instead o

f those accepted by the art world, he made a conscious effort to ________ the established art world.
Social Studies
1 answer:
Drupady [299]4 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Rebel against.

Explanation:

Robert Rauschenberg, the popular painter as well as graphic artists of America, in his famous work Monogram employed a distinct array of non-conventional art materials and the methods instead of the ones which are already accepted by the world. He rather paid attention to make conscious attempts to <u>'rebel against'</u> the established world of art. He aimed to escape from the conventional art materials and foresaw the heading of a pop art movement. Therefore, he rebelled against the traditional form and proposed distinct 'variety of non-traditional forms' as well as the methods that offered a transition from the conventional form.

Bob decided that he was a bit overweight and in order to do something about it, he created a new exercise program, something he'
vodka [1.7K]

Answer:

a) Maintenance stage

Explanation:

The stages of change model are pre-contemplation stage, contemplation, determination, action, relapse, and the maintenance stage.  In the maintenance stage, people are now able to sustain their change in behavior for a period of more than 6 months, and have a strong determination to maintain the change in behavior. Bob, just like people in this stage of change is reinforcing himself by buying new CDs each month in order for him not to relapse to earlier stages of change.
